This is a plugin meant to help maven user to download different files on different protocol in part of maven build. The source plugin creates a jar archive of the source files of the current project. Maven always download sources and javadocs stack overflow. This is an excerpt from the scala cookbook partially modified for the internet. Learn how to search an apache maven repository and download libraries to your project from within intellij idea. But when youre working with an open source library,such as gson,typically you can download and integrate the jar filemore quickly and more automaticallyby downloading it from something called a maven. Android maven plugin can be used to both consume and produce android archives aar. Maven content library stay up to date on everything maternity and family benefits related with this collection of mavens proprietary resources. Artifacts with sources deployed can be attached to eclipse libraries using downloadsources. If you want to let other developers use your library, you could simply send them the whole directory and let them include it in their project.
May 14, 2014 single module, not maven or gradle, and the libraries are in a lib directory. The maven dependency plugin should be used whit the dependency. Is there a way i can configure maven to always download sources and javadocs. In my project i am using a jar file provided via maven. Its true that an android library module is actually just a bunch of source codes grouped in the same directory. Its a little more involved, but once you have maven installed and created a new project, downloading the source jar for your current version is fairly straightforward. Contribute to apachemaven development by creating an account on github. Aug 31, 2011 everything will be stored in our maven repository from now on. Google has decided to prohibit the android sdk artifact android. When working on a scala project built with sbt, you want to use a java library thats in a maven repository, but the library doesnt include information about how to use it with scala and sbt. But what maven gives me is only this jar no javadocs and no sources. Scm doge automates maven projects checkout and release process merging release branch into master, finalizing pom. But latter, i tried to use this solution to download source, it failed without any message.
Use a source archive if you intend to build apache maven compiler plugin yourself. Able to download source javadoc artifiacts to depsrc folder for declared or transitive dependency which is provided by play, for easier debugging using command mvn. Maven should now redownload the library and hopefully install it properly. This is clearly not correct, but i couldnt see an obvious way to make maven prefer the local copy of the code to the remote copy. Stay uptodate on the latest family benefits news and trends. Download libraries from maven repos linkedin learning. You can download release source from our download page. In eclipse ide, its better to use the maven eclipse plugin. Able to download all dependencies not provided by play into lib folder, with src and javadoc. Specifying ddownloadsourcestrue ddownloadjavadocstrue everytime which usually goes along with running mvn compile twice because i forgot the first time becomes rather tedious. Simply pick a readymade binary distribution archive and follow the installation instructions. Get javadoc for jar, normally, developers dont provide this. Use a source archive if you intend to build apache maven archetypes yourself. Powered by a free atlassian confluence open source project license granted to joget.
Jan 14, 2015 in maven, you can get source code for project dependencies in most ides like this. In order to guard against corrupted downloadsinstallations, it is highly recommended to verify the signature of the release. I unchecked download artifact sources at eclipse maven setting, so it only download the jar. Jul 16, 2010 downloadattach source codejava docs with maven dependencies. Apache maven eclipse plugin attach library sources.
How to download source jars from maven repository hi, im using ant version1. Build source code on windows knowledge base for v5 joget. Jan 01, 2020 a detailed listing of the most popular, recently updated and most watched maven packages online. Maven is distributed in several formats for your convenience. Posted july 16, 2010 by girish gaurav agarwal in java, maven. Instructor i previously described the processfor integrating a jar file into an intellij project. Use a source archive if you intend to build maven release yourself. This library uses several boost libraries to create a complete soap server implementation during compile time based on the signature of exported methods. Javadocs may be attached using downloadjavadocs the sources and javadocs of the libraries must exist in the repository so that the plugin can download it and attach it.
Commonsio contains utility classes, stream implementations, file filters, and endian. Goal that resolves the project source dependencies from the repository. First, edit your servers configuration file to indicate which proxy to use. A simple mvn install fails with the following warning.
Feb 20, 2016 why should we setup a private maven repository. This package contains runtime shared libraries for libgsm, an implementation of the european gsm 06. Maven question here right now if you do a maven build in the tools or examples directory, maven will go and download the library from nexus instead of using the source in the core directory. How to download sources and javadoc artifacts with maven. Get source jar files attached to eclipse for maven managed dependencies. I couldnt seem to find a link anywhere on the maven site. Oct 15, 2017 the apache commons io library contains utility classes, stream implementations, file filters, file comparators, endian transformation classes, and much more. The maven source plugin creates a jar archive of the source files of the current project. Patch needed to build libgsm as a shared library github. Otherwise, simply use the readymade binary artifacts from central repository. Pulling source code from maven repository aureaworks. I removed the jar folder in maven local repository and download the jar again, then the source jar downloaded success. The jar file is, by default, created in the projects target directory. The download jar file contains the following class files or java source.
When youre using maven in an ide you often find the need for your ide to resolve source code and javadocs for your library dependencies. Thats the right processto use for your own custom jar files. Goal that resolves the project source dependencies from the. Maven external dependencies as you know, maven does the dependency management using the concept of repositories. Downloadattach sourcecodejavadocs with maven dependencies. Under project settings, i dont see any libraries listed says nothing to show instead of a list. I have installed m2eclipse and i also checked option download artifact sourcesjavadoc in settings. Maven frequently asked technical questions apache maven. How to setup a private maven repository for inhouse android. How do i download source jars from remote maven repository.
262 1080 538 1097 149 1417 1589 1255 1115 279 367 46 424 1312 1329 577 261 24 594 25 934 1052 135 346 1099 616 284 924 1253 713 1008 1440 1317 741 567 1142 434 900 340 1442